Phulnakhara: Police here Saturday seized four trucks and two earth-movers from Srikorua sand mine on Kathajodi river embankment under Sadar police limits on charges of quarrying sand illegally. However, the vehicle drivers fled the scene. Sources in the police said the truck owners have been fined Rs 22 lakh for lifting sand illegally from the particular sand mine. Acting on a tip-off about illegal sand mining in the area, a team of Sadar police raided the spot and seized the vehicles. It is worth mentioning here that the locals of the area have been complaining of illegal sand mining from the river embankment. The locals had also reported the matter to the Sadar tehsildar.
